Samsung Galaxy M21 leaks with information from M11 and M31

Samsung is working on new M-series phones, mid-range devices. The company knows of the interest of customers in having alternatives to high-end smartphones and whose prices are in some cases exorbitant when compared to the Galaxy Note 10.

For the time being the first three of the line will be the M11, M21 and M31, the last one has already gone through GeekBench leaking little data from its hardware. Now it's the turn of the second, the Galaxy M21 with the model number SM-M215F and who increases several things when compared to the M20 from 2019.

Among the data thrown is the storage, it can be purchased in capacities of 64 GB and 128 GB, enough knowing the use of photos, videos and apps. The system usually occupies a small quota of all the space and mention that the included software will be the One UI 2.0 layer.

There are two designated CPUs for the Samsung Galaxy M21, Exynos 9610 or 9611, the first of which is an eight-core chip that reaches up to 2,3 GHz and is manufactured under the FinFET architecture. The Exynos 9611 is an improved version of the 9610, it has eight cores, four at 2,3 GHz and the other four working at 1,7 GHz respectively.

Colors of the three models

Samsung will offer the Galaxy M11, M21 and M31 in blue and black, the third tone will be differential in each of them, the M11 will have purple, the M21 with a green tone and the M31 closes with a red one.

The company could announce the M11 and M21 in January as it did with the Galaxy M10 and M20, including the same in some of the events in which it will participate. The Galaxy M31 is a somewhat later bet and the ideal appearance act would be the Mobile World Congress in Barcelona.
